Discography

Pure and Simple is Kirk MacDonald's latest release. New Beginnings - Kirk MacDonald’s release on Radioland was nominated for both a 2001 Juno Award as well as a Canadian Indie Music Award. The Atlantic Sessions - his previous release, has garnered rave reviews and has received two of Canada’s most prestigious music awards. The 1999 Juno Award for Best Mainstream Jazz Release and The 1999 Jazz Report Award for Album of the Year. In addition, Kirk won The 1999 Jazz Report Award for Tenor Saxophonist of the Year. As a member of The Chris Mitchell Quintet, Kirk MacDonald also received The 1999 Prix de Jazz from the Montreal International Jazz Festival.
